Another Yankee with a twin-turbocharged V8, the SSC Tuatara has been the root of some speed record controversy. Five years ...
The YANGWANG U9 Xtreme is already the fastest car on the planet – and now the performance flagship of BYD's luxury sub-brand ...
Overview EVs offer top speed, performance, and cutting-edge technology for sports car loversElectric sedans and SUVs now ...